Grammar usage guide and real-world examples

USAGE SUMMARY

The phrase "growth usage" is not standard in written English and may cause confusion.
It could be used in contexts discussing the usage or application of something that is growing or expanding, but it is not commonly recognized. Example: "The growth usage of social media platforms has transformed marketing strategies."

FAQs

What are some alternatives to the phrase "growth usage"?

You can use alternatives like "increased utilization", "expanding application", or "growing adoption" depending on the context.

Is "growth usage" grammatically correct?

While not technically incorrect, "growth usage" is not a standard or commonly used phrase in English. Ludwig AI suggests it is not standard in written English and may cause confusion.

How can I use the phrase "growth usage" in a sentence?

The phrase "growth usage" can be used to describe the increase in the extent to which something is used. For example: "The growth usage of social media platforms has transformed marketing strategies."

What is the difference between "growth usage" and "usage growth"?

"Growth usage" refers to the usage or application of something that is growing or expanding, while "usage growth" describes the increase in the use of something over time. The latter is more commonly used.
